Chlorine in PDB 2xp2: Structure of the Human Anaplastic Lymphoma Kinase in Complex with Crizotinib (Pf-02341066)

Enzymatic activity of Structure of the Human Anaplastic Lymphoma Kinase in Complex with Crizotinib (Pf-02341066)

All present enzymatic activity of Structure of the Human Anaplastic Lymphoma Kinase in Complex with Crizotinib (Pf-02341066):
2.7.10.1;

Protein crystallography data

The structure of Structure of the Human Anaplastic Lymphoma Kinase in Complex with Crizotinib (Pf-02341066), PDB code: 2xp2 was solved by M.Mctigue, Y.Deng, W.Liu, A.Brooun, S.Timofeevski, T.Marrone, J.J.Cui,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 36.76 / 1.90
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 51.633, 57.086, 104.709, 90.00, 90.00, 90.00
R / Rfree (%) 20.7 / 25.2

Other elements in 2xp2:

The structure of Structure of the Human Anaplastic Lymphoma Kinase in Complex with Crizotinib (Pf-02341066) also contains other interesting chemical elements:

Fluorine (F) 1 atom

Reference:

J.J.Cui, M.Tran-Dube, H.Shen, M.Nambu, P.P.Kung, M.Pairish, L.Jia, J.Meng, L.Funk, I.Botrous, M.Mctigue, N.Grodsky, K.Ryan, E.Padrique, G.Alton, S.Timofeevski, S.Yamazaki, Q.Li, H.Zou, J.Christensen, B.Mroczkowski, S.Bender, R.S.Kania, M.P.Edwards. Structure Based Drug Design of Crizotinib (Pf-02341066), A Potent and Selective Dual Inhibitor of Mesenchymal-Epithelial Transition Factor (C-Met) Kinase and Anaplastic Lymphoma Kinase (Alk). J.Med.Chem V. 54 6342 2011.
ISSN: ISSN 0022-2623
PubMed: 21812414
DOI: 10.1021/JM2007613
